About the role

Regeneron is looking for an outstanding Program Manager to implement IT projects for Preclinical Manufacturing & Process Development (PMPD). This role will work with PMPD stakeholders to perform robust project planning and execute upon that plan to completion, aligning to the project management of scope, time and cost. This role is based at Tarrytown, NY location with a minimum of 4+ days onsite per week required; this role is not open to fully remote or hybrid work arrangements.

Responsibilities

  • Lead large-scale projects with varying degrees of complexity
  • Lead small projects involving multiple project workstreams, acting as a single point of contact for those activities
  • Utilize agile methodologies such as Scaled Agile Framework (SAFe)
  • Recommend and take action to direct the analysis and solution of problems
  • Communicate with stakeholders on an ongoing basis; estimate resources and participants needed to achieve project goals; draft and submit budget proposals and recommend subsequent budget changes where necessary; handle multiple projects as necessary
  • Plan and schedule project timelines and milestones using appropriate tools; track project milestones and deliverables; develop and deliver progress reports, proposals, requirements documentation and presentations
  • Act as the go-to-person and single point of contact for a specific process, product, function or system
  • Coordinate with IT and department managers to assess and track plans, status, etc. for timely delivery of critical projects and programs; this includes assisting teams and the project teams in removing impediments and resolving cross-team issues
  • Responsible for defining project objectives clearly and rally a team around the value delivery plan
  • Anticipating risks before they become issues

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ree
  • Proven work experience in research, pharmaceutical, biotechnology, or scientific laboratory environment implementing IT systems
  • Expert user of a variety of technologies (Planview, Jira, MS tools, etc.) and processes (SDLC, PMO, etc.)
  • Must be open to travel periodically (~5%) to represent Regeneron as needed and for internal meetings

Qualifications

  • Previous project management in a Research organization is preferred

Pay

Salary Range (annually) $114,800.00 - $187,400.00
